Paleo-Waffles Part 2

In about a month and a half of eating Paleo, I have tried about 10 different versions of Paleo-Pancakes (pretty much a different recipe each time I cooked pancakes). And I have a slight feeling that Waffles will be suffering the same fate.

Last week, I randomly threw together ingredients and achieved a pretty decent result:

IMG_20120401_172639

Ingredients for 8 – 10 waffles:

1 banana (pureed)
120g melted butter
1 tbsp honey
Juice of 1/2 lemon
4 eggs
150g buckwheat flour
50-100 ml coconut milk (add little by little)
1-2 tbsp cinnamon
1 tbsp baking powder

Just work yourself down the list and keep mixing to create a smooth dough. Then bake your waffles one at a time and once done top with fruit and whipped cream ….
